*UPDATE* Easton Police Determine Bomb Threat at Oliver Ames High School Not Credible

Chief Keith Boone reports that the Easton Police Department has determined that a bomb threat at Oliver Ames High School this afternoon was not credible and there is no current danger to the public.

Easton Police Investigating After Antique Cartridge Found at Middle School

Police Chief Gary Sullivan and Superintendent Lisha Cabral report that the Easton Police Department is investigating after a single antique ammunition cartridge was found inside of the Easton Middle School Friday morning.
